David Sutton is an Assistant Professor in the Department of Classics at the University of Toronto. His academic work bridges Latin literature, Roman social history, and interdisciplinary studies of the ancient world.
Research interests include:
- Latin poetry and prose (Martial, Catullus, Ovid, Horace, Pliny the Younger)
- Ancient masculinity, friendship, and social desire
- Homosociality and normativity in Roman societies
- Translation theory and practice
- Classics pedagogy in modern universities
- Historical marginality in the Mediterranean world (slavery, ethnicity)
Teaching activities encompass Latin/Greek language instruction at all levels, lecture courses on myth and Graeco-Roman civilization, and seminars focused on Sexuality and Gender, Marginal Identities, and the Ancient Novel.
